{"data":{"id":"us-vt/13-v.s.a.-8003","jurisdiction":"us-vt","citation":"13 V.S.A. § 8003","heading":"Limitation on scope","body":"(a) This chapter does not provide a basis for:\n(1) invalidating a plea, conviction, or sentence;\n(2) a cause of action for money damages;\n(3) a claim for relief from or defense to the application of a collateral consequence based on a failure to comply with this chapter; or\n(4) seeking relief from a collateral consequence imposed by another state or the United States or a subdivision, agency, or instrumentality thereof, unless the law of such jurisdiction provides for such relief.\n(b) This chapter shall not affect:\n(1) the duty an individual’s attorney owes to the individual;\n(2) a claim or right of a victim of an offense; or\n(3) a right or remedy under law other than this chapter available to an individual convicted of an offense.","path":["Title 13: Crimes and Criminal Procedure","Chapter 231: Uniform Collateral Consequences of Conviction"],"source_url":"https://legislature.vermont.gov/statutes/section/13/231/08003","current_through":"2025 session","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-05T17:16:59Z","sha256":"8d9745202360a597815aeb3a85b7d313b95e4f0fc8569285d4b33245082c3082","source_id":"us-vt","stale":false,"prev":"us-vt/13-v.s.a.-8002","next":"us-vt/13-v.s.a.-8004"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
